Laford Massengale, 91, of Pioneer, died Thursday morning, March 25, 1999, at
Methodist Medical Center of Oak Ridge.Mr. Massengale was born in Scott County on July 6, 1907, the son of Franklin and Mary Jane Massengale.
He had been a member and deacon of River View Missionary Baptist Church
at Smokey Junction since November 1941.Mr. Massengale is survived by six daughters, Delsie Chambers and her husband, Earl, of Straight Fork, Tenn., Rosie Jane Cook, Hazel Massengale and Aneda Thrasher, all of Oak Ridge, Macil Murrell and her husband, Larry, of Seymour, and Murtle Midge Carson and her husband, William, of Clinton; and a daughter-in-law, Betty Jean Massengale of Petros.He is also survived by three sisters, Celia Cross, Locie Hembree and Linda Lowe, all of the Smokey Junction area; two sisters-in-law, Mertie Anderson and Martha Brannim; 10 grandchildren, Starlet, Pamela, Keith, Mark, Debbie, Ellen,Crystal, Billy, Eric and James; 19 great-grandchildren; nine
great-great-grandchildren; and by several nieces and nephews.His wife, Birdie Ellen Massengale, died earlier. A son, Clifford Massengale,three infant children, a grandson, Rickie Chambers, four brothers, Esau Massengale, Levie Massengale, Elmer Massengale and McKinley Massengale,and five sisters, Elizabeth Cross, Sylvania Harness, Louella Bunch, Dora Carroll and Vianna Carroll, are also deceased.The funeral was held Saturday, March 27, at River View Missionary Baptist Church with the Rev. Keith Massengale and the Rev. Tom Owens officiating.Burial followed at Smokey Junction Cemetery. Pallbearers were Billy Lowe,Clem Lowe, Kern Lowe, Curtis Massengale, Gary Massengale, Clarence Carroll, Kenneth Lowe and Dillard Massengale. Honorary pallbearers were Keith Massengale, Brian Massengale, Mark Massengale, Billy Carson, Eric Carson, James Thrasher, Richie Chambers and Jimmy Crowley.West Murley Funeral Home in Oneida handled arrangements.
